Believers who hold strong religious beliefs may experience internal conflict when faced with their own desires and those imposed by their faith. This is especially true for individuals with strict religious views regarding sex and sexual expression. While some believe that sexual intercourse within marriage is permissible under certain conditions, others have even more restrictive guidelines, forbidding all forms of physical contact between members of different genders. Such constraints can be challenging to navigate, particularly given how innate sexual desire can become.

Many believers find themselves torn between what they feel in their hearts and what they have been taught is right according to scripture. They may struggle with feelings of shame, guilt, fear, and confusion about exploring these aspects of their lives. For some, this leads to repression and suppression, while others attempt to find ways to satisfy their needs without violating their values.

One common approach is abstinence, or refraining from all sexual activity until marriage. Some adherents see this as the only acceptable choice, while others may view it as an extreme measure that does little to address their underlying desires. Those who remain celibate may experience loneliness, isolation, and other psychological consequences. Others may turn to masturbation, pornography, or other substitute behaviors to meet their needs.

Many believers are able to reconcile their religious beliefs with their desires through mindfulness and self-discipline. By setting clear boundaries and finding alternative outlets for sexual energy, such as exercise or creative pursuits, they can stay true to both their spirituality and their human nature. This requires a deep level of honesty and self-awareness, as well as an understanding of one's own limitations and temptations.

In sum, navigating the tension between sexual desire and religious prohibition is a complex process that requires careful consideration and personal reflection. It is not something that can be easily resolved overnight but rather a journey that takes time, patience, and compassion.
